About Medan
Medan, the capital of North Sumatra, is a bustling city known for its rich cultural heritage, vibrant culinary scene, and historical landmarks. It serves as a gateway to the stunning natural beauty of Lake Toba and the surrounding highlands.
Getting There and Around
Arrival
Airports: Kualanamu International Airport is the main airport serving Medan, located about 39 kilometers from the city center.
Train Stations: Medan Railway Station is a major hub for train travel in the region.
Bus Terminals: The Pinang Baris Bus Terminal offers intercity bus services.
Transportation
Public Transport Options: Medan has a network of public buses and angkot (minivans) for getting around the city. Motorcycle taxis, known as ojek, are also popular for short trips.
Car Rentals: Various car rental companies operate in Medan, offering options for self-driving.
Bike Shares: Bike sharing services are not widely available in Medan.
Tips: Traffic in Medan can be congested, so it's advisable to plan travel during off-peak hours.

Local Customs and Etiquette
Culture Insights
Medan embraces a blend of cultures, and it's important to show respect for the diverse traditions and customs observed by the local communities.
Greetings
Common greetings include 'Selamat pagi' (Good morning), 'Selamat siang' (Good afternoon), and 'Selamat malam' (Good evening). Handshakes are customary in formal settings.
Social Behavior
Hospitality is highly valued, and it's polite to accept offers of food or drinks when visiting someone's home. Modesty in dress and behavior is appreciated, especially in religious sites.
Cultural Taboos
Avoid pointing with your feet, as it is considered disrespectful. Refrain from touching someone's head, as it is regarded as sacred in Indonesian culture.
